#[non_exhaustive]pub struct VariantOffsets {
    pub standard: UtcOffset,
    pub daylight: Option<UtcOffset>,
}Expand description
Represents the different offsets in use for a time zone
Fields (Non-exhaustive)§
This struct is marked as non-exhaustive
Non-exhaustive structs could have additional fields added in future. Therefore, non-exhaustive structs cannot be constructed in external crates using the traditional 
Struct { .. } syntax; cannot be matched against without a wildcard ..; and struct update syntax will not work.standard: UtcOffsetThe standard offset.
daylight: Option<UtcOffset>The daylight-saving offset, if used.
